Founded in 2017

It started with ₦3,000 and one pot.

Barr. Olufunmi Adepiti—formerly known as Olufunmi Ehuwa—began Tasty Corridors in a single room in Makoko, Lagos, cooking with a charcoal stove and a determination to turn familiar Nigerian flavours into useful, well-made products.

The business grew from prepared Aganyin sauce into a wider range of ready-to-eat sauces, ready-to-cook mixes, spices and traditional staples. Today, the company operates from a dedicated production facility in Ikosi-Ketu, Lagos.

That same journey now supports wholesale supply, private-label manufacturing, diaspora orders, food-processing training and the Bucket Jollof food-delivery brand.
